Eukaryotic translation initiation factor 1 pseudogene 4 is a human pseudogene belonging to the EIF1 family but does not encode a functional translation initiation factor. Pseudogenes are genomic DNA sequences similar to normal genes but typically nonfunctional due to mutations or lack of regulatory elements. Unlike active translation initiation factors (such as EIF1, EIF4A, or EIF4E), EIF1P4 is a non-coding genomic segment with no demonstrated biological activity, druggability, or disease relevance. It is generally excluded from therapeutic or biomarker consideration and may only possess minor roles in gene regulation, such as acting as competing endogenous RNA, but such functions have not been substantiated or widely described in scientific literature[3]. Key distinctions: EIF1P4 is distinct from functional translation initiation factors such as EIF1, EIF4A, or EIF4E, which are active roles in mRNA translation, cellular proliferation, and have relevance to cancer and other diseases[1][2]. EIF1P4 does not encode any protein or participate in translation, signaling, apoptosis, immune response, or cell cycle regulation. There is no evidence for drugs, safety issues, or biomarker uses related to EIF1P4. Summary: EIF1P4 ("Eukaryotic translation initiation factor 1 pseudogene 4") is a human pseudogene and not a real molecular target; it has no therapeutic, biological, or biomarker relevance, and is likely included by mistake if considered a drug target or functional receptor[3].
